> Using msynctool syncs 114 contacts of about 510 and then stops its
> messages and never ends. Cpu load rises over 95% which is apparently
> caused by the barry-plugin of opensync. I can only recover by disconnect
> usb cable which leaves me always a dirty sync.
> I tried also to raise the number of contacts to synchronize step by step
> but I never manage to sync more than 114 contacts.
> Backup and restore with the gui works fine.
> btool seem to work as well so far.
> upldif works with more than 114 contacts (my current workaround for
> contacts)


When you sync, do you have contacts on both sides?  i.e. contacts on the
Blackberry as well as the other member of the sync group?  If you do,
then you will run into similar problems that you are describing, since
conflict handling in opensync 0.22 is fairly poor.
